In her new memoir The Escape Artist, bestselling author Helen Fremont (After Long Silence) writes about growing up with parents who pretended to be Catholics but were really Jewish survivors of Nazi-occupied Poland. Triggered by the news that she has been disowned by her family after her father’s death, Helen explores her tumultuous relationship with her older sister Lara, whose mental instability was not acknowledged or discussed, and the ripple effect of dysfunction on the entire household.
